Welcome. You'll inherit pages for Gullwing, our metrics-aggregation sidecar. Basics: it scrapes local process metrics every 15s, batches, and ships upstream. Most pages are either OOM kills (restart, then raise the memory limit via the fleet config) or upstream timeouts (check the collector tier before touching the sidecar). Never disable the sidecar on a production host — dashboards go dark fleet-wide. Page acknowledgement window is ten minutes. Runbook, dashboards, and escalation contacts are all linked from this page:

operations page: https://jenkins.zemvarcloud.local/job/merge_requests/repo/build/73930b4b30f0a8ed

Handover note — Larkfield catalogue import

Welcome aboard. The nightly import pulls MARC records from the Brindlewood consortium feed into Shelfwright. The dedupe pass runs before indexing, so don't reorder the pipeline stages. Failures land in the quarantine queue; reprocess them only after the checksum job finishes. Miren left everything green last Friday. The importer reads its runtime settings from the block below, so keep it in sync with staging.

settings of tagef-bawif:
DRUIX_HOST=druix.zemvarlabs.internal
DRUIX_PORT=8000

**Mgmt Meeting Minutes — Retiring the Brightline Range**

Quick recap for sales leads at Fenholt Supplies: we agreed to retire the Brightline fixture range by year-end. Remaining stock moves to clearance pricing next month, and accounts on standing orders get migrated to the Lumetta range. Trade-in incentives were approved in principle. The confidential note on next steps sits just below.

board note of bajof-bajeg: The pricing group signed off on a budget of $13.4 million for Project Sildor. The renewal with Lamixek Holdings closes at $48.9 million a year, 49 percent above the last contract.

## Rotation: keyspin-cli

Review scope: the rotate-on-deploy hook only. keyspin-cli swaps credentials in Vaultling, then signals the Pemberton scheduler to restart consumers. Rollback is automatic if the health probe fails twice. Do not approve changes that widen the grace window past 90s; downstream caches assume that bound. Verify the hook reads the active profile before signing off. The current configuration values are listed below.

service settings:
[casax]
port = 6379
team = rusir
host = casax.zemvarhq.corp
region = outer-4
access_code = ac_9808ce
timeout_ms = 1500